The initial approach was to run BLE and Wi-Fi simultaneously. Provisioning sometimes worked. It seems like there was some interference. Then switched to run BLE with Wi-FI off. When I got Wi-Fi credentials, switched BLE off, and turned Wi-Fi on. It still had some issues. Turned out when slowed down SPI bus, it started working.
